PE-5760 Equivalent & Substitute Parts Reference

Part Overview

The PE-5760 is a 5mH pulse transformer with 1:1:1 turns ratio configuration, designed for through-hole mounting applications. This component features a compact form factor of 0.500" L x 0.350" W with a maximum seated height of 0.250". The PE-5760 is classified as obsolete, making identification of suitable substitute components essential for ongoing system support and new design implementations.

Substitute Part Grouping Explanation

Substitution eligibility for the PE-5760 is determined by the following critical parameters:

  • Inductance value: 5mH (exact match required)
  • ET (Volt-Time) product: 25VµS (exact match required)
  • Turns ratio configuration: 1:1 or 1:1:1 (functionally equivalent)
  • Mounting type: Through Hole (physical compatibility)
  • Physical dimensions: 0.500" L x 0.350" W and 0.250" maximum height (PCB layout compatibility)
  • Operating temperature range: 0°C ~ 70°C (minimum requirement)

The PE-5760NL qualifies as a direct substitute based on matching inductance, ET product, turns ratio, mounting type, and physical dimensions. The primary distinction is product status and compliance certification.

Engineering Selection Recommendations

The PE-5760NL is the designated substitute for the obsolete PE-5760. Both components share identical electrical specifications (5mH inductance, 25VµS ET product) and physical dimensions, ensuring functional and mechanical compatibility in through-hole applications.

The PE-5760NL offers the advantage of active product status, ensuring continued availability and supply chain reliability. Additionally, the PE-5760NL carries RoHS compliance certification, meeting current regulatory requirements for electronic component manufacturing and assembly.

Selection between these components should be based on compliance requirements and supply availability. For new designs or systems requiring regulatory compliance, the PE-5760NL is the appropriate choice. For legacy system maintenance where RoHS compliance is not mandated, either component is electrically and mechanically equivalent.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

Q: Can PE-5760NL be used as a direct replacement for PE-5760 in existing designs?

A: Yes. Both components have identical inductance (5mH), ET product (25VµS), turns ratio (1:1 configuration), mounting type (through-hole), and physical dimensions (0.500" L x 0.350" W x 0.250" max height). Electrical and mechanical compatibility is confirmed.

Q: What is the primary difference between PE-5760 and PE-5760NL?

A: The PE-5760 is obsolete with RoHS non-compliant status. The PE-5760NL is an active product with RoHS compliance certification. Electrical and physical specifications are identical.

Q: Are there any packaging differences between these components?

A: Both components are supplied in tube packaging. No packaging format changes are required for substitution.

Q: What does the turns ratio notation 1:1:1 versus 1:1 indicate?

A: The PE-5760 specifies a three-winding configuration (1:1:1), while the PE-5760NL specifies a two-winding configuration (1:1). Both maintain 1:1 voltage and impedance ratios between primary and secondary windings, ensuring functional equivalence in standard pulse transformer applications.

Q: Is the operating temperature range identical for both components?

A: Yes. Both the PE-5760 and PE-5760NL operate across the 0°C to 70°C temperature range.
